I went with reliance motor insurance vide policy no [protected] in Dec 2015. Payment of policy premium was made online. Then on 28/01/2016 I have received the recovery letter from Reliance General Insurance regarding the recovery of the NCB amount of Rs.1106 saying that the NCB provided by the previous insurer was 35% and reliance have provided me with 45%. Can I please know where this NCB have been entered by me during registration. Is it my fault? I have read about the NCB calculation on your portal and it clearly states that the NCB is calculated as per the age of the vehicle. And the age of my vehicle is 3 years. So according to this the NCB must be 35%. From where do this 45% came in my policy. I am really disappointed of how the calculation was done online despite I clearly filled the details of my vehicle. Please check the calculation before issuing any policies. I have not faced such issues before for my previous policies. I have not entered any NCB from my side and the calculation has been done online itself. I have written so many emails to reliance regarding the same on their email id rgicl.[protected]@relianceada.com. But i have not received any concrete answer from them and just receive the system generated emails. If reliance is not accepting their fault then please return my money back so that i can go for some other insurer.

                                    My Toyota Innova Car (Maxi Cab) met with an accident on 2 Dec 2014. The process of filing the claim with with the insurance company with relevant documents have been completed within 3 days from the date of accident. The insurance company has taken almost 5 months to authorise repairs in spite of my repeated visits to the Insurance Company office and meeting the Claims Manager (Mr Satish Acharya, Mobile No. [protected]) to expedite the process. I had several letters written with acknowledgements obtained from them and umpteen number of SMSs and telephone calls for which I have not received a single reply/response. You can imagine this has happened to me, as I myself is an insurance professional worked in the middle east for almost 15 years in a general insurance company particularly dealing with motor claims. One can guess what kind of treatment a layman customer will get into a situation like this with a company of Reliance General Insurance. Now after the repair work has been completed by a local garage, the insurance company in connivance with the Surveyor (Mr M N Nagaraj, Mob. [protected]) is now asking me to agree for a settlement of the claim for Rs. 1, 34, 321 for the repair invoice of Rs. 2, 60, 000 from the local garage, the dealer, M/s Ravindu Toyota has estimated the loss of Rs. 4, 25, 000. These unscrupulous Surveyor has a dubious distinction of getting kickbacks from the local garages by manipulating the claims. I have won cases against insurance companies from the Consumer Forums in Bangalore in which this Surveyor is involved. When I visited the insurance company couple of days back to find out the status, they are getting into bizarre arguments saying that the assessed loss for glass parts will be paid at 25% of the actual cost whereas the policy terms & conditions clearly says that there are no depreciation on all parts of glass. The company executive even try to argue that the assessed loss for glass. I do not understand where is the question of assessed loss for a glass. I simply asked the question what do you mean by assessed loss for a glass. Does the surveyor mean the glass parts can be repaired/reinstated to its original shape unlike other mechanical/metal parts which can be repaired, if not replaced. The insurance company again is blundering on their arguments that lamps, either head lamps, tail lamps or fog lamps are made of plastic which do not form part of glass. Can any one believe their arguments. As per the dealer's repair estimate, the damaged glass parts itself cost around 72, 000, which is 100% payable, reasonable labour for this kind of damage shall be around 72, 000, other metal parts considered costing Rs. 1, 15, 000, totalling the repair invoice to be Rs. 2, 60, 000 taking into consideration appropriate depreciation as per the policy which states 40% for the insured vehicle is of 5 years old. In fact, the depreciated we have calculated on the damaged parts is 50% as against 40% prescribed in the policy schedule. The insured has suffered huge financial loss the delay in authorising repairs for 5 months and the actual delivery of the repaired vehicle was done after six months from the date of accident. Since the insured vehicle is a commercial cab, it has to earn revenue for the insured to meet its financial commitments like EMI on the car loan, salary to the driver, quarterly taxes to the government, insurance cost, maintenance, etc. On an average the insured car has to earn Rs. 4, 000 per day to meet these financial commitments. Under these conditions, the undue delay caused by the insurance company in arranging repairs to the insured car has resulted in a financial loss of Rs. 6 lakhs (for 5 months delay, i.e. 150 days @ Rs. 4, 000 per day). The surveyor has collected the repair invoice and some relevant KYC documents for settling the claim on 15 April 2015 and has taken two months to submit the same to the insured company, has written a letter to the insured to again submit the above documents within 7 days failing which he will treat the claim as close. How arrogant is he to write such a letter to the insured, since the insured has no direct contract with the surveyor. The insured has written a letter to the General Manager of the insurance company to respond on or before 20 June 2015 with a reasonable settlement, failing which the insured intend to take the matter with the concerned Consumer Forum for justice of his legitimate claim.
